Type
ORACLE
Validation date
2024-02-12 02:52: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03774,
    "usd": 0.04075
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00015E33E827B3DFE056A5867F9B250B72672A62FFD89722AA9680F7CF544B818686

Previous signature

182BD65F6EB3B386407C29109A20648AAF5D285E6B666AF3C98345139E14E4E0FAC969674EE70CA77FA6B99915EFBD1025BCA34F77EFE92DF65A881A9BF01C04

Origin signature

304402206729577B7CCD62BBAA1D2C3C33D830DD6C3401D976B7133DE0784CF94169C2F902207EE883B63F3C239C8184C94533BDAA936E2DE7016CA75B816A3191FF40323ECC

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

0085B0B88834A4A244189918DFC4AAE8DE964FD014EE43C25A2462152D2FF51441

Coordinator signature

8A364A39C5E4F5EAE6DD40095AFCEF30937B1332F3C4C0C2BF65FB700BB0A07CE9F949CEFB502F1797679FBA84196880225BD74663542D9B435F1C84FBDE0B06

Validator #1 public key

0001FE0F759D8C583CB8351DB3F1BA2F045F114F0BA7600CCEC9048E48CC3E5FE4AF

Validator #1 signature

5C9BD6B834283906667D879577332D347F9409FD887F39C2D2CE145B4003C3E327EED23D0FE414848E4782A9539D8F5B8FC2E778F2E5EB24D9CD57C80CD7EB0E

Validator #2 public key

0001F6081DDC1AC8BCE9CC8727A38B5A8A449BA45DFD746D0FD412006309825D0D79

Validator #2 signature

8BDB75A868237A6F9A2F86EF258E9CF0E6D0D5E588390EE93FF9A09651BF5777C9470C0408BBECCE9F5396EAB4E734A8E87AAF8755ED20E6834BCF3E0FA40006